Moses Kipsiro will be trying to give a shot at the 5000m, trying to console his 10000m performance where he finished 10th overall at the London 2012 Olympic Arena Saturday.

CECAFA Club championship top scorer and back-to-back title medal winner Hamisi Kiiza Diego has been honoured by his feat as Uganda’s sportsperson for the month of July, at the monthly scribe’s meeting.
